Acupuncture

Acupuncture is the insertion of fine needles into the body at specific points to regulate the body’s energy and bring it into balance. This ancient procedure has been shown to be effective in the treatment of specific health problems. Conditions such as chronic illness, allergies, and high blood pressure are just a few that can be successfully treated with acupuncture. Acupuncture is just one branch of a full system of Oriental Medicine, which also includes Herbal Medicine, Tui Na (muscular and joint manipulation), Nutrition and Qi Gong (meditation and energy work).


Herbal Medicines

For thousands of years the Chinese and other eastern people have studied plants and herbs. Over the centuries they developed powerful and complex herbal formulas that can be used in conjunction with acupuncture or alone to help restore or maintain health. Unlike western herbalism, which tends to focus on the use of an individual herb, Chinese herbal formulas typically contain several varieties of herbs that were traditionally boiled into a tea or soup. Today, most are available in pill or capsule form.

Chinese herbal formulas are generally considered safe and usually sold as dietary supplements. However, it is important to work with a qualified practitioner when using herbal medicines.  In addition to calories and nutrients, every food also has a nature and a flavor. A food's nature has an effect on one's body temperature. Thus a food can make a person hot, cold, warm, cool, or neutral. This is important when treating diseases or constitutions that are hot or cold in nature. Also, foods are chosen according to their flavors: salty, bitter, spicy and sweet. Each flavor has an effect on various organ systems: sweet affects the spleen and stomach in digestion; bitter the heart; sour the liver; and spicy flavor the lungs. Although these therapeutic properties are less dramatic and work slower acting than herbs or other medications, they are extremely important because foods profoundly affect all body systems.

Modern man has created and uses an astonishing number of chemicals on a daily basis. In the US alone, there are approximately 80,000 different chemicals registered for use, with more than 3,000 chemical additives found in the foods we eat.  According to reports from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and The Environmental Protection Agency, hundreds of these toxic chemicals are present in the average American’s body. And these aren't our only concern. Internally our bodies produce toxins through through normal, everyday functions. Biochemical, cellular, and bodily activities generate free radicals.  When these are not eliminated, they can cause irritation or inflammation of the cells and tissues, inhibiting or even blocking normal cell functions.  

A healthy, normal functioning body was designed to manage certain levels of toxins effectively.  But excess exposure/intake of toxins coupled with our internal toxin production can stress our natural detoxification systems. A food-based Detox Program (sometimes called purification or cleanse) helps support your natural detoxification systems.
